The Arkansas Sale of Business — Promissory Not— - Asset Purchase Transaction is a legal document that outlines the terms and conditions of selling a business in the state of Arkansas. This transaction involves the transfer of assets from the seller to the buyer, with the purchase price being financed through a promissory note. In this type of transaction, the seller agrees to sell and transfer their business assets, including equipment, inventory, and intellectual property, to the buyer. The buyer, in turn, agrees to pay the purchase price over a designated period of time through installments, as outlined in the promissory note. The promissory note is a legally binding agreement that serves as a promise from the buyer to pay the seller the agreed-upon purchase price. It includes details such as the total purchase price, payment terms, interest rate, default provisions, and any collateral or security interests required to secure the buyer's payment obligations. There are different types of Arkansas Sale of Business — Promissory Not— - Asset Purchase Transactions that may vary based on the specific terms and conditions agreed upon by the parties involved. Some common variations include: 1. Full Purchase Price Promissory Note: This type of transaction involves the buyer agreeing to pay the entire purchase price in installments over a set period of time, with interest. 2. Partial Purchase Price Promissory Note: In this variation, the buyer agrees to pay a portion of the purchase price upfront and the remaining balance in installments. 3. Balloon Payment Promissory Note: This type of promissory note includes regular installment payments but with a larger final payment, often referred to as a balloon payment, due at the end of the term. 4. Secured Promissory Note: This variation includes the buyer providing collateral, such as real estate or business assets, to secure the payment obligations outlined in the promissory note. The Arkansas Sale of Business — Promissory Not— - Asset Purchase Transaction is essential in protecting the rights and interests of both the buyer and the seller. It helps ensure that the buyer receives the agreed-upon assets, while the seller is assured of receiving the purchase price as agreed upon by both parties.
